2.
7
Additional
Voices
Can
Be
Transferred
VOICE
MENU
Your
ME-10
has
seven
additional
voices
which
can
be
used
by
transferring
them
to
any
grey
buttons
in
any
VOICE
section.
1
Determine
which
voice
to
transfer
and
which
section
you
wish
to
transfer
that
voice
to.
These
voices
in
the
VOICE
MENU
section
can
be
transferred
to
any
of
these
grey
buttons
from
the
VOICE
section.

2
While
depressing
the
grey
button
in
the
VOICE
section
where
you
wish
to
transfer
the
sound,
press
the
button
of
the
voice
to
be
transferred.

When
a
grey
button
is
pressed,
the
lamp
inthe
VOICE
MENU
lights
up,
enabling
the
eight
(rhythm)
buttons
to
function
as
the
VOICE
MENU.
(They
normally
function
as
the
pattern
selectors
for
Auto
Rhythm.)
While
this
lamp
is
lit,
press
one
of
the
seven
buttons
from
TROMBONE
to
PIPE
ORGAN.
The
lamp
of
the
grey
button
in
the
VOICE
Section
you
transferred
it
to
flashes
to
indicate
that
the
sound
has
been
transferred.
Please
try
trans-
ferring
other
voices
using
this
same
procedure.
Note
that
if
the
POWER
switch
is
turned
off,
the
voices
transferred
to
the
grey
buttons
will
be
returned
to
their
Original
Voices
(the
voices
as
displayed).
L
[Checking
the
Transferred
Voices]
When
a
grey
button
is
pressed,
the
lamp
of
the
voice
transferred
to
that
button
will
light
up,
indicating
which
voice
was
transferred.
If
no
voices
from
the
VOICE
MENU
have been
transferred
to
that
location,
the
ORIGINAL
VOICE
lamp
lights
up.

When
the
ORIGINAL
VOICE
BUTTON
is
pressed
while
depressing
the
grey
button,
you
can
cancel
the
sound
transferred
to
that
button
and
return
to
its
displayed
voice.
[Additional
Information]
@The
same
voice
can
be
transferred
to
multiple
grey
buttons.
@When
a
VOICE
MENU
sound
has
been
transferred
to
SOLO
or
PEDAL
VOICES,
they
automatically
become
“monophonic”
voices,
meaning
that
only
one
note
at
a
time
can
be
played.
3.
Using
Sustain
SUSTAIN
This
feature
permits
the
sound
to
gradually
fade
out
after
an
Upper
Keyboard
(Orchestral
Voices
only)
and/or
a
Pedal
note
is
released.
1
turn
on
the
UPPER
button.

2
Select
a
sound
from
the
Upper/
Lower
ORCHESTRAL
VOICES,
then
play
the
upper
keyboard.
After
releasing
the
keys,
a
gradual
fade-out
is
added
to
the
sound.
Even
when
TO
LOWER
is
on
and
Orchestral
Voices
are
being
produced
from
the
lower
keyboard,
the
Sustain
effect
is
active.
